I wonder if it is possible to be able to have control over how WSDLs are generated for JSR-181 EJB3 endpoints ?
The problem is that although the automatically generated WSDLs look fine, the client (StrikeIron) does not generate proper SOAP requests unless minor changes are made to WSDLs. Of course it is possible to save the WSDLs, edit them and refer from @WebService, this is what I am currently doing. However, I'd like to be able not to do this every time something is changed in endpoints, i.e. new method added.
Is there an editable template JBossWS uses to generate WSDLs at deployment ?
